In Roquemaure in France at the end of 1843, the church organ had recently been renovated. To celebrate the event, the parish priest persuaded poet Placide Cappeau, a native of the town, to write a Christmas poem. Soon afterwards, in that same year, Adolphe Adam composed the music. The song was premiered in Roquemaure in 1847 by the opera singer Emily Laurey. American music critic, minister, and editor, John Sullivan Dwight, adapted the song into English in 1855. This version became popular in the United States and throughout the years has been recorded by hundreds of artists, including Celine Dion, Neil Diamond, the cast of Glee and Josh Groban.
